MAC array for data computation
The invention provides an MAC (Media Access Control) array for data calculation, which comprises a plurality of array units, and each array unit comprises a plurality of sub-MAC modules, a first shifter and a first summator; wherein the first end of the first sub-MAC module is connected with the fir...
Saved in:
Main Authors | , , , |
---|---|
Format | Patent |
Language | Chinese English |
Published |
18.04.2023
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| The invention provides an MAC (Media Access Control) array for data calculation, which comprises a plurality of array units, and each array unit comprises a plurality of sub-MAC modules, a first shifter and a first summator; wherein the first end of the first sub-MAC module is connected with the first end of the first summator, the first end of the second sub-MAC module is connected with the first end of the first shifter, the second end of the first shifter is connected with the second end of the first summator, and the output end of the first summator serves as the output end of the array unit; the first shifter is used for realizing shifting of output data of the second sub-MAC module; and the first adder is used for adding the output data of the first sub-MAC module and the output data of the first shifter. Therefore, the MAC array supports the mixed precision data format through splitting and shift accumulation of the data, so that the MAC array can be configured according to the target data format, and |
---|---|
Bibliography: | Application Number: CN202310012131 |